What is the paperless ticket model?

The paperless ticket model is a digital solution that replaces traditional paper tickets—such as queue tickets, appointment tickets, or receipts—with 100% digital alternatives. This transition is achieved through the use of technologies such as QR codes, mobile notifications, integrated applications, and digital screens in establishments. Instead of handing the customer a piece of paper, the information is communicated efficiently and ecologically through digital channels.

    How does it work?

    The process is simple and streamlined for the customer:

    1. Scanning or data entry

    Upon arrival at the establishment or collection point, the customer scans a QR code or enters their details on a digital kiosk.

    2. Reception of the turn

    Receive your turn in digital format directly on your mobile device or view it on the screens at the premises.

    3. Wait without worry

    While waiting for your turn, you can move around freely without worrying about losing a physical paper.

    Advantages of the paperless ticket model

    For the environment:

    • Waste reduction: in Europe, more than 58 billion paper receipts are printed every year, generating millions of tonnes of waste.

    • Reduced environmental impact: paper production involves high consumption of natural resources and energy.

    For businesses:

    • Operational efficiency: Eliminates the need to print and manage physical tickets.

    • Improved customer experience: Offers a more agile and modern service.

    • Data analysis: Allows you to collect information on customer flow and optimise resources.

    For consumers:

    • Convenience: Quick and easy access to appointments from mobile devices.

    • Security: Elimination of the risk of loss or damage to physical tickets.

    • Sustainability: Contributing to reducing paper use and protecting the environment.

    Applications in different sectors

    Physical stores

    In physical establishments, the paperless ticket model is used for paperless queue management. Customers can scan a QR code upon arrival, receive their queue number digitally, and wait comfortably without the need for a physical ticket.

    E-commerce

    In the digital realm, the model is applied to appointment and shift management. Users can schedule services online and receive confirmations and reminders through digital channels, improving efficiency and the user experience.
